JAKARTA - Jordi Cruyff started his work as Technical Advisor for the Indonesian National Team after arriving in Jakarta, Tuesday. March 11, 2025.

He immediately revealed the right criteria for the person who will fill the position of Technical Director (Dirtek) of the Garuda Squad.

"I think you have to have experience with different countries, cultures and strategies. He (Dirtek) must be able to work with coaches in all age groups," said Jordi Cruyff during a press conference in Jakarta on Tuesday, March 11, 2025, afternoon WIB.

Not only that, according to Cruyff, a Director of Technology is also required to perform optimally for the football of a country and even the Indonesian National Team (Timnas).

"He has to help from day to day. He has to be able to formulate strategies and ways to achieve goals."

"He must have abroad experience so that he can adapt quickly to new places," said Jordi.

"The point is that we have to work together and have a new direction with the same goal," he continued.

Jordi Cruyff's suggestion regarding the figure of the Director of Technology is directly proportional to the existing situation. The reason is, the position of the Director of Research and Technology of the Indonesian National Team is currently vacant after being left by Indra Sjafri who had moved to handle the U-20 Indonesian national team.

Although currently the position of the Director of Technology is still being sought, the presence of Jordi Cruyff will be quite helpful. The problem is, after retiring as a player, he has a number of experience as a sporting director.

Jordi was once Director of AEK Larnaca Sports, then at Maccabi Tel Aviv. In 2021, he will become a strategic advisor at Barcelona who continues to be Director of Blaugrana Sports.
